Review of Hot Shots! Part Deux (1993) by Jared F — 13 Sep 2009
Jim abrahams does it again. and this time its 10 times better than the first. charlie sheen once again appears as topper, this time playing a sort of "rambo" part instead of characters in top gun.
in fact, this movie is more of a parody of the action genre in general with parodies of classic action movies like rambo first blood part 2, commando, and various war movies, also referencing other classics such as platoon, total recall, robocop, karate kid, and even star wars and wizard of oz.
the comedy in this is so unexpected and random that there are rarely any parts where I wasn't cracking up hysterically. lloyd bridges returns as benson, now the president of the USA, still a bumbling idiot, but nevertheless hilarious.
other various characters return from the first as well, such as valeria golino and ryan stiles, and newcomers richard crenna (playing a parody of his own character in the rambo films) and the beautiful brenda bakke, playing another perpetual love interest for topper.
once again, I highly recommend this, especially since its even better than the original.
